Consider Pramipexole or Gabapentin for Restless Legs Syndrome
About one in 40 Americans need treatment for restless legs syndrome...uncomfortable urges to move the legs or arms while at rest.
Restless legs syndrome often has no known cause...but may be linked to iron deficiency, pregnancy, end-stage renal disease, SSRIs, or SNRIs.
Suggest leg massage or stretches for acute relief...and moderate-intensity exercise for possible long-term improvement.
